The Importance of Soil Health in Landscape Upkeep
Soil health provides the foundation for efficient landscape care, shaping plant growth and ecosystem stability. Healthy soil is full of organic matter, nutrients, and beneficial microorganisms, confirming that plants obtain the important elements necessary for excellent development. This nutrient-rich environment fosters vigorous root systems, boosts water retention, and encourages biodiversity, establishing a flourishing ecosystem.
Periodic ground evaluation is indispensable for identifying nutrient shortages and inequalities. This data empowers landscaping specialists to implement tailored amendments, such as compost or fertilizers, to repair soil health. Additionally, practices like protective covering and cover cropping can prevent soil loss and strengthen soil structure.
In addition, maintaining soil pH within an optimal range is necessary for nutrient absorption. By giving priority to soil health, landscape maintenance services can construct resilient, sustainable outdoor spaces that not only promote lush plant life but also improve the overall ecological balance of the environment.
What's the Best Way to Water Your Landscape Effectively?
Effective garden irrigation is essential for advancing healthy plant growth and managing water resources. To realize ideal results, gardeners should assess several strategies. Drip watering systems channel water directly to the roots, minimizing evaporation and runoff. This system is particularly productive for vegetable gardens and flower beds.
Sprinkler systems, whether stationary or rotating, furnish broader coverage and are fitting for bigger areas. Timers can automate watering schedules, ensuring steady moisture without excess watering. Additionally, layering mulch around plants helps maintaining soil moisture, reducing the frequency of watering.
Tracking soil moisture is imperative; gardeners can use moisture meters to establish when watering is necessary. Early morning is the finest time to irrigate, as it allows plants to take in water before the heat of the day. By executing these strategies, gardeners can sustain a verdant, healthy garden while using water resources economically.
Pest Control Methods for Successful Landscape Care
Implementing robust pest control plans is essential for preserving a lush landscape. Effective pest management begins with continuous monitoring to recognize infestations early. Landscape professionals often apply integrated pest management (IPM) techniques, which combine biological, cultural, and mechanical methods to curtail chemical use. This approach encourages the use of beneficial insects like ladybugs and lacewings, which effectively control pest populations.
Furthermore, suitable plant choice and positioning can improve resilience to insects. Indigenous species, for copyrightple, are typically more resilient and attract helpful organisms. Regular maintenance practices, such as trimming and clearing waste, also help minimize pest habitats. When needed, targeted pesticide applications can be employed, concentrating on the specific pest and reducing impact on non-target species. By implementing these strategies, outdoor care professionals can create a flourishing outdoor space, guaranteeing plants remain vigorous and lively while successfully controlling insect numbers.
What's the Best Way to Get Ready Your Landscape for Every Season?
Designing a garden area for each period requires careful thought and strategic planning. In spring, it is vital to assess plant condition and begin trimming, adding mulch, and applying fertilizer to encourage growth. Periodic flowers can be planted for color and visual interest.
When summer approaches, consistent watering and pest management are paramount. Lawn care, featuring mowing and aeration, guarantees a lush appearance.
As autumn begins, attention moves to removing foliage and preparing plants for dormant season. Splitting perennials and planting bulbs for spring blooms are proven techniques during this time.
Winter readiness emphasizes keeping fragile plants safe from frost and snow. Applying mulch protects roots, while selective pruning of certain plants can minimize harm from ice.

What Indicators Show Soil Compaction?
Symptoms of soil compaction reveal poor drainage, water collection, decreased vegetation, observable fractures in the soil surface, and difficulty inserting a garden fork or digging spade. Healthy soil should fall apart readily and enable root expansion.
